What is your typical process for working with a new student?
I teach Photography for the absolute beginner! First, I evalute your goals and tell you the best way to go about learning them. One on one classes are very hands-on from day one.
I like to evaluate the areas of strengths the person already possesses and begin building from that. In the beginning, I focus less on camera settings than I do on focus, composition, light, etc. Technical skills will be learned as we shoot and can be practiced at home. We do learn all the basics like shooting in manual mode, depth of field, focal planes, proper exposure (possibly flash) and any other requests.
